Re: Best splitter...does it really matter?

Your kind of asking for trouble if your going to finish off that ceiling and no longer have access to that splitter. You might want to think about installing an access panel there or re-run your coax wires while the walls or ceilings are open and homerun them to somewhere else that is accessible. I've been to homes where they have paneled over where their phone lines terminate or coax cables and the customer is stuck with opening the ceilings to isolate a problem.
